When a low-level S.H.I.E.L.D. agent gets a hold of Hank Pym's new Ant-Man suit, you know the Marvel Universe is in trouble. He's not concerned with saving the world or helping others. He's concerned with getting through the day and getting a leg up on life.
He's not going to use his powers responsibly, he's going to use them for the betterment of himself. He's Ant-Man, a new 'hero' for the modern world. But it also costs money to be on the run from the law.
Luckily, Damage Control is on the lookout for someone who can safely sift through rubble for survivors. Don't worry, though - he'll still have plenty of time to spy on the ladies like the despicable human-being that he is.
If you thought Robert Kirkman pushed the boundaries of what could be in a Marvel Comic with MARVEL ZOMBIES, just wait until you see what he does in here! 272 pages.
This title collects
Irredeemable Ant-Man #1-12
